Comment préparer Ginger Biscuits

  1. Preheat your oven to 150°C (300°F/Gas Mark 2). Line your ba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the flour, ginger, sugar, and baking powder. Mix well to ensure even distribution of spices.
  3. Cut in the cold butter using a pastry blender or your fingertips until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  4. Gradually add the milk, mixing until a soft, pliable dough forms. Do not overmix.
  5.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face and gently roll it out to about ½ inch thickness.
  6. Use cookie cutters to cut out your desired shapes (8 wedges, 12-16 rounds or ovals). Alternatively, cut the dough into your preferred shapes using a knife.
  7. Place the biscuits onto the prepared baking sheets, leaving some space between each one.
  8.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den brown. Keep a close eye on them to prevent burning.
  9. Let the biscuits cool on the baking sheets for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ely. Enjoy!
